The transformation of Juraj Slafkovsky is quite incredible. Since December, he has been producing at a rate of nearly one point per game, surpassing players like Jack Hughes at the same age.

It's easy to forget that Slafkovsky is only 20 years old, and he just turned 20 two weeks ago. His progress is far from over, and he will become even stronger physically and more dominant.

One aspect of his game that was lacking was his shots per game. Too often, analysts, fans, and even Martin St. Louis told him to use the weapon he possesses.

In the last 6 games, this has drastically changed.


"Slafkovsky is shooting like never before. He had 6 shots against Flyers and this time he was rewarded with 3 goals.

His shots per game:
October: 1,11
November: 1,64
December: 1,31
January: 1,62
February: 2,73
March: 1,85
Last 6 games: 4,67"

- Via Stefan Bugan

It's an incredible breakout, and it's no coincidence that he is so close to the 20-goal plateau in his second season. We wish him well, as he has four more games to score a goal and reach this prestigious milestone!
